SkinCeuticals C E Ferulic

  • SkinCeuticals C E Ferulic
  • SkinCeuticals C E Ferulic

This is the serum most dermatologists reach for first, and the one nearly every other formula on the market has tried to replicate. It combines a high concentration of pure vitamin C with vitamin E and ferulic acid, a trio that works together to neutralize free radical damage from sun and pollution while visibly improving fine lines and uneven tone. It's best for someone who wants the clinical, proven-in-studies option and is willing to invest in it.

The texture is a touch tacky on first application and the scent is distinct, not for everyone, but it absorbs well and layers cleanly under moisturizer, sunscreen, and makeup. If your skin tolerates actives well and you want the gold standard, this is it.

Drunk Elephant C-Firma Fresh Day Serum

  • Drunk Elephant C-Firma Fresh Day Serum

This serum earns its spot for a formula that closely mirrors the SkinCeuticals classic, at roughly half the price. It arrives in two parts, a liquid serum and a vial of pure vitamin C powder you mix in yourself, which keeps the vitamin C stable and potent until the moment you use it. It's best for someone who wants clinical-grade brightening and firming without the luxury price tag.

Testers consistently note a visible tightening effect and a brighter, more even complexion within weeks, along with fading of new dark spots. It's potent enough to cause mild tingling on first use, so it's better suited to skin that's already comfortable with actives. The bottle is also genuinely travel-friendly, with a convertible pump that makes it easy to pack.

TruSkin Vitamin C Serum

  • TruSkin Vitamin C Serumv

This is the serum to start with if you're new to vitamin C or have skin that reacts to stronger actives. It uses sodium ascorbyl phosphate, a gentler, more stable form of vitamin C, paired with vitamin E, aloe, and jojoba oil, so it delivers brightening benefits without the sting or redness that pure L-ascorbic acid formulas can cause. It's best for sensitive skin, first-timers, or anyone who wants a low-commitment way to add vitamin C to their routine.

Results build gradually, usually over six to eight weeks, rather than the faster shifts you'd see from a higher-concentration formula, but the payoff is a serum that layers comfortably under anything and rarely causes irritation. At its price point, it's one of the best-reviewed options on the market.
